## Tuning for SDK Parity

If you're building plugins against both the Lumabrook JS and Kotlin SDKs, heads up: we keep their retry and batching behavior in lockstep, but the defaults are tuned per platform. The JS client leans toward smaller batches to keep the event loop happy, while Kotlin can chew through bigger payloads. Don't hardcode these in your plugin — read them from the client config so parity updates flow through automatically. The current cross-SDK tuning constants are listed below.

tuning table, yajog-yahof:
BUDGETS = {
    "lamvan": 303,
    "wenox": 460,
    "fenvan": 525,
}

Hey Dov — quick handoff on the Pellbright audit-log viewer. Filtering and pagination are done; the retention banner still needs polish. Watch out for the date-range picker, it assumes UTC everywhere. Tests pass locally and in CI. For review, you'll want the viewer pointed at staging with the following settings:

config for hahaf-kafof:
[wenys]
host = wenys.torvahq.corp
user = wenys_svc
database = wenys_prod

Subject: DR drill — PlayHouse seat-map renderer

Hi,

This Friday we're running the disaster-recovery drill for the Coralton Theatre seat-map renderer. You're observing as security reviewer. The restore target is the isolated staging rack; rendering state rebuilds from snapshot. When the restore console asks for credentials, use the drill recovery passphrase. For your review packet, it appears directly below.

vault phrase of bagaf-kajeg = jorath-feniel-briir-siliel-ralix